During the taking of its physical inventory on December 31, 2013, Waterjet Bath Company incorrectly counted its inventory as $728,660 instead of the correct amount of $719,880. Indicate the effect of the misstatement on Waterjet Bath's December 31, 2013, balance sheet and income statement for the year ended December 31, 2013. Also record the amount of each overstatement or understatement. Enter all amounts as positive numbers.
Answer and Explanation:
Since in the question it is mentioned that
Incorrectly amount recorded = $728,660
And, the corrected amount is = $719,880
The difference is
= $728,660 - $719,880
= $8,780
Based on the misstatement, the effect on the financial statement is
For Balance sheet:
Overstatement of Merchandise inventory = $8,780
Overstatement of Current assets = $8,780
Overstatement of Total assets = $8,780
Overstatement of Owner equity = $8,780
For Income statement:
Understatement of Cost of merchandise sold = $8,780
Overstatement of Gross profit = $8,780
Overstated of Net income = $8,780
which of the following constitutes an implicit cost to company A
A. property taxes
B. Payments of wages to its office workers
C. raw material costs paid by company A to the supplier B
D. value of the land owned by the company A
Answer:
Implicit cost to company A is:
D. value of the land owned by the company A
Explanation:
Implicit costs to company A will refer to the cost of resources already owned by the firm, which the company could have put to some other use. A good example is the value of the land owned by the company. This land could be put to another use, yielding some rent. It could also be sold outright. Its cost becomes implicit when the company uses it in its business. The land is not being held for sale.

If the reserve requirement is 20% and commercial bankers decide to hold additional excess reserves equal to 5% of any newly acquired checkable deposits, then the effective monetary multiplier for the banking system will be
Answer: 4
Explanation:
Based on the information provided in the question, the effective monetary multiplier for the banking system will be calculated as:
= 1/Reserve ratio
= 1 / (20 + 5%)
=1/(0.20+0.05)
= 1/0.25
= 4
Therefore, the effective monetary multiplier for the banking system is 4.

To determine your capacity to pay back debt, use the debt service ratio and debt safety ratio.
Both the debt service ratio and the debt safety ratio evaluate how much of your monthly income is required to pay off your debt. While your debt safety ratio measures your monthly consumer debt payments to your monthly take-home pay, your debt service ratio compares your total monthly loan payments to your gross monthly income. These computations are significant for two reasons.
First, refraining from taking on more debt than you can manage by keeping your debt service ratio and debt safety ratio within sustainable bounds. Second, loan officers often use comparable calculations to establish your eligibility for credit cards, mortgages, and auto loans.

List three pieces of information listed in a credit card agreement that you believe are important to review before
Explanation:
Annual Percentage Rate (APR). This is the cost of borrowing on the card, if you don’t pay the whole balance off each month. You can compare the APR for different cards which will help you to choose the cheapest. You should also compare other things about the cards, for example, fees, charges and incentives
Minimum repayment. If you don’t pay off the balance each month, you will be asked to repay a minimum amount. This is typically around 3% of the balance due.
Annual fee. Some cards charge a fee each year for use of the card. The fee is added to the amount due and you will have to pay interest on the fee as well as on your spending, unless you pay it in full.

Suppose that because of the popularity of Jack Brown's, Aaron decides to open a third restaurant and issues another round of $10,000 one-year bonds. If the interest rate on the bond falls to 12%, the price of these new bonds is $???
12% = $10000 - X Divided by X Times 100
The price of the new bonds given the face value and interest rate is $8,928.57.
What is the price of the bonds?Bonds are debt instruments issued by a firm with the purpose of raising capital to carry out projects. The price of the bonds can be determined by discounting the face value of the bonds by the interest rate.
The price of the bonds = face value of the bonds / ( 1 + interest rate)
$10,000 / (1.12) = $8,928.57

ABC reports income tax expense of $800,000. Income tax payable at the beginning and end of the year are $50,000 and $70,000, respectively. What is the amount of cash paid for income taxes
Answer: $780,000
Explanation:
Income taxes paid for the year are:
Cash paid for income taxes = Beginning income tax payable + Income tax expense - Ending income tax payable
= 50,000 + 800,000 - 70,000
= $780,000

Define Interpersonal Intelligence.
Answer:
Interpersonal intelligence is a concept introduced by Howard Gardner as part of his theory of multiple intelligences. It refers to the ability to understand and interact effectively with other people. People who possess interpersonal intelligence are skilled at recognizing and understanding the emotions, motivations, and intentions of others. They are also able to communicate effectively and build strong relationships with others.
Explanation:
Listening, social intelligence, and effective communication are all elements of interpersonal intelligence. Effective leaders, teachers, and counsellors are frequently those with good interpersonal intelligence. They are capable of building a solid connection with others and earn their trust and respect. Emotional intelligence, which is increasingly acknowledged as a key component of both personal and professional success, includes interpersonal intelligence.
The capacity to comprehend and work well with others is referred to as interpersonal intelligence. Effective verbal and nonverbal communication, the capacity to recognize individual differences, and sensitivity to others' moods and temperaments.
How does one define intrapersonal intelligence?Intrapersonal intelligence is the ability to reflect on oneself, to be aware of one's own strengths and limitations, feelings, and mental processes—all of which go to make up one's own self-knowledge.
What role does interpersonal intelligence play?Being more interpersonally intelligent can help you communicate with others more effectively. It might enable you to make more sincere acquaintances or turn out to be a reliable source of emotional stability and support.
